Vital Pressure Points
It is important to know what areas of the body to attack &
know what areas are dangerous if struck.
We teach self defence at Kimpton which involves locks, holds,
throws & pressure points, to fend off an attacker

Self Defence / Pressure points - Kimpton Karate Club
HEAD
1. Top of head
2. Frontal Area
3. Temple
4. Base of nose
5. Bridge of nose
6. Eyes
7. Upper lip
8. Lower edge of jaw
9. Articulation of lower jaw
FRONT OF BODY
10. Cavity below ears
11. Side of neck
12. Adams apple
13. Top of sternum
14. Bottom of sternum
15. Solar plexus
16. Lower abdomen
17. Rib cage - below armpits
18. Rib cage - below nipples
19. Rib cage - either side of abdomen
20. Testicles
21. Side of stomach
22. Inner part of upper thigh
23. Outside of thigh
24. Knee cap and joint
25. Shin
26. Top of foot
27. Elbow
28. Back of hand
Self Defence / Pressure points - Kimpton Karate Club
BACK OF BODY
29. Spine
30. Back of head
31. Back of neck
32. Kidneys
33. Tip of spine
34. Back of upper thigh
35. Lower calf
36. Back of knee
37. Ankle
